MAITLAND, FL— Author Valerie L. Lawson-Watkins recounts the details of a true testimony that would be deemed a tragedy by most. Within the pages of her new book, "No Sad Story": A Story of Unconditional Love under Life's Pressures, ($16.99, paperback, 9781498405935; $8.99, e-book, 9781498409896) Valerie shares an intimate look inside the household of a wife, and her adulterous husband and former pastor, infected with the AIDS virus. Eventually, the author’s parents split. Valerie’s mother was left alone to face the challenge of raising six children, while fighting a terminal illness.

“I want to let readers know that God has not forgotten them, and by trusting His Word, they too will have the testimony of my mom: ‘no sad story,’” states the author. “HIV/AIDS is not a subject that is exposed very much in our church arena. The subject still carries negativity with it even if it wasn't your fault. Even though my mom was infected, she still ministered; she was believing for healing, so she could bring hope and healing to that community.”

Valerie Laverne Lawson-Watkins is no medical expert on HIV/AIDS, but she has lived through both parents’ battle against the virus, and she knows all too well the negative effects of such a process. The author feels the mandate to tell her mother’s story to others who are challenged with the same plight. Valerie surrendered her life to Christ at the tender age of eight years old when her father preached in a revival. As the only daughter that was raised with five brothers, her mother was her best friend. As an author, Valerie Laverne Lawson-Watkins can now thank her mother for living and showing her that she, too, can have “No Sad Story.”
